Situated on one of Cheltenham's most established residential roads, Cleevelands Drive is a substantial detached family home set within a generous plot, offering well-balanced accommodation together with a double garage.
The property is approached via a gravel driveway providing ample parking and creating an attractive approach to the house. Mature planting and established boundaries provide privacy, while the house itself offers spacious and flexible accommodation suited to modern family living.
The reception hall gives access to the principal living areas. A dual-aspect sitting room is a particularly bright room, benefiting from views to both the front and rear. A second reception room provides useful additional space and is well suited as a family room, study or playroom. To the rear of the house is a spacious kitchen/dining room which forms the heart of the home. The bespoke kitchen is fitted with a comprehensive range of units, integrated appliances and a central island, enjoying direct access to the terrace and garden beyond. A substantial dining area makes for a generous space for everyday family life and entertaining. A separate utility room and cloakroom complete the ground floor accommodation.
On the first floor, a spacious landing gives access to four well-proportioned bedrooms. The principal bedroom is particularly generous and benefits from fitted storage and a well-appointed en suite shower room. A second double bedroom also enjoys its own en suite facilities, making it well suited for guests or older children. Two further bedrooms are served by a modern family bathroom, providing flexible accommodation for a growing family. The bedroom layout is both practical and well balanced, Outside, the rear garden is predominantly laid to lawn and bordered by mature trees and established planting, providing an excellent degree of privacy. A paved terrace adjoining the house offers plenty of space for outdoor dining and entertaining.
The property also benefits from a double garage and extensive driveway parking.
Cleevelands Drive is a well established popular residential area, on the northern side of Cheltenham, within half a mile of the town centre and with a regular bus service, or a leafy walk through Pittville Park. The parks are within easy reach as are the Pump Rooms and the famous Prestbury Park (Cheltenham) racecourse.
Less than a hundred miles from London it nestles beautifully between the Cotswold Hills and the Wye Valley, and is home to numerous prestigious schools including Cheltenham College, Cheltenham Ladies College, Dean Close and Pates Grammar.
